MOTW: Dead Snow
2014-05-15 08:06:57 Today’s fave film is the Norwegian horror comedy Dead Snow (Død Snø). Created by Hansel & Gretel: Witchhunters director Tommy Wirkola, Dead Snow takes place in Northern Norway, where a group of friends accidentally discover a troop of undead Nazis. Mahem ensues. An absolute must see for zombie fans! 5 of 5 stars
